What this means

This registration is in, or will soon enter, a USPTO maintenance window. Missing a Section 8 or Section 9 filing can cancel the registration.

Status 800: Status 800 means the registration was renewed after acceptable combined Section 8 and Section 9 filings. The mark remains registered for another 10-year term with active federal protection.

Goods and services

ClassDescriptionStatusFirst use
007Compressed air pumps; air compressors; electric vacuum cleaners; electric car polishers; electric winches; electric compressors, compressors for machines; electric welding machines; pneumatic nailing machines; high pressure washers; power-operated tools, namely, pneumatic hammers, pneumatic drills, pneumatic shears, electric wrenches, electric hand drills, electric hand routers, electric hand circular saws, electric drills, automatic electric screwdrivers, pneumatic screwdrivers, pneumatic staplers, pneumatic nail gunsACTIVE
